Subject: [PATCH] NFS: Always initialise fattr->label in nfs_fattr_alloc()
Git-commit: d4a95a7e5a4d3b68b26f70668cf77324a11b5718
Patch-mainline: v5.16
References: git-fixes
We're about to add a check in nfs_free_fattr() for whether or not the
label is non-zero.
